Gary Griggs, Our Ocean Backyard | A disappearing pier

If you had been walking, biking or driving along West Cliff Drive in early 1989, you would have noticed a pier extending several hundred feet out into the ocean from the end of Almar Avenue. This was a temporary structure built to allow the placement of the inner portion of a new Santa Cruz wastewater outfall line. Santa Cruz has been treating sewage at the wastewater treatment plant near Neary’s Lagoon and disposing of the effluent in the ocean since 1928, nearly a century now.
